Аудит 14 производственных сайтов за последние три месяца показал, что более 90% из них подверглись серьёзным нарушениям доступности по Европейскому закону о доступности (EAA). Это сигнал для разработчиков: исправление этих ошибок может улучшить пользовательский опыт для миллионов пользователей.
Обнаруженные нарушения
Сайты, которые проверялись, включали интернет-магазины и SaaS-платформы. Кодовые базы варьировались от чистого HTML до Next.js и WordPress. Главным сюрпризом стало выявление пяти одинаковых нарушений на почти всех сайтах — проблем, которые легко устранить.
Пять распространённых нарушений доступности
1. Отсутствие или бессмысленный alt-текст
Это нарушение было зафиксировано на 13 из 14 сайтов. Наиболее распространённые ошибки заключались в отсутствии атрибутов alt или неинформативных записях вроде «image1.png». Это создает значительные затруднения при использовании сайта для пользователей с ограничениями по зрению.
2. Формы без связанных меток
На 11 из 14 проверенных сайтов были обнаружены поля форм с текстом-заполнителем, но без соответствующих меток. Это создает проблемы как для обычных пользователей, так и для пользователей экранных считывателей. Решение заключается в добавлении видимых или скрытых меток для обеспечения доступности.
3. Недостаточный цветовой контраст
Каждый проверенный сайт имел хотя бы одно нарушение в цветовой контрастности. Наиболее частая ошибка — использование светло-серого текста на белом фоне. Требования WCAG требуют, чтобы соотношение контраста было не менее 4.5:1 для обычного текста.
4. Интерактивные элементы без описаний
Ряд сайтов содержал кнопки и ссылки без соответствующих описаний, что затрудняло взаимодействие пользователей с вспомогательными технологиями. Каждый интерактивный элемент должен иметь чёткое описание его функций.
5. Неполная навигация
На 9 из 14 сайтов наблюдались проблемы с навигацией, затрудняющие поиск нужной информации. Каждая страница должна быть доступна и логично структурирована.
Значение доступности для разработчиков
Исправление этих нарушений значительно повысит качество и доступность сайтов, что приведёт к большему вовлечению пользователей и повышению конверсии. Стандарты доступности важны не только для соблюдения законов, но и для реальных пользователей.


